Two killed, several people kidnapped in Kwara church attack; Saraki urges Tinubu to wake up

“I call on the federal government…to urgently act to ensure that the kidnapped victims …and return home safely to their loved ones,” said Mr Saraki.

The police command in Kwara has confirmed bandits’ attack on the Christ Apostolic Church (CAC) Oke Isegun, in Eruku, Ekiti LGA on Tuesday, saying at least two people were killed and one other wounded.

In a video circulating online, the armed bandits stormed the church, shooting sporadically with worshippers scrambling for safety.

Multiple reports said the bandits kidnapped an unspecified number of worshippers during the attack.

In a statement on Tuesday, the command spokesperson, SP Adetoun Ejire-Adeyemi, said the divisional police officer, alongside police operatives and local vigilantes, responded after gunshots were heard from the outskirts of the community.

“The Kwara state police command confirms an attempted bandit attack in Eruku, which occurred at about 18:00 hours of today, 18th November 2025.

“Upon thorough search of the area, one male victim Mr Aderemi was discovered fatally shot inside the Christ Apostolic Church, Oke Isegun while one Mr Tunde Asaba Ajayi another victim of fatal gunshot was found in the bush,” said the police.

The command added a vigilante, Segun Alaja, who was shot and wounded, was taken to a hospital in Eruku for medical treatment.

Police commissioner Adekimi Ojo commended the prompt response of the police and vigilante teams, assuring residents of continued commitment to tracking down the perpetrators.

Reacting to the attack, former Senate President Bukola Saraki urged the federal government and security agencies to urgently ensure the freedom of kidnapped victims.

“I call on the federal government, particularly the heads of our security agencies, to urgently act to ensure that the kidnapped victims of this sad incident regain their freedom and return home safely to their loved ones. I also enjoin the security agencies to put a solid arrangement in place that will secure Eruku town, in particular, and all parts of Kwara state,” Mr Saraki said in a statement on Wednesday.

The latest attack came amid a disturbing rise in banditry, killings and kidnappings for ransom in different parts of the country.

On Monday, a gang of armed bandits with sophisticated weapons, shooting sporadically, stormed the Government Girls Comprehensive Secondary School, Maga, Danko district, Danko/Wasagu LGA of Kebbi, abducting 25 students and killing the vice principal.

Armed bandits also attacked the Kushe Gugdu community in Kagarko LGA in Kaduna, killing one person and abducting a Catholic priest, Bobbo Paschal.
